The New Bohemians hail from Dallas, Texas, where they started life as a Ska band with Brad Houser on bass, Eric Presswood on guitar, and Brandon Aly on drums. What I Am This song is by Edie Brickell & New Bohemians and appears on the album Shooting Rubberbands at the Stars (1988) and on the compilation album Ultimate Collection (2002).
